The purpose of an inspection is to verify compliance with the approved plans and other local, state and federal laws which are enforced by the code enforcement agency. No building or structure may be used or occupied, nor any change to the existing occupancy classification of a building or structure, until the Building Official has issued a Certificate of Occupancy.
At specific stages of construction, the permit applicant or contact is responsible for scheduling with the Building Division the required inspections.

It is also the responsibility of the person doing the permitted work to provide access to and a means for inspection of the work. The area to be inspected must be accessible and exposed for inspection purposes. A reinspection fee of $86.00 may be assessed for each inspection or reinspection when the work for which the inspection is called is not complete or when corrections are not made.
